Insite International need 1x CPCS/NPORS Dozer Driver to work in Aberdeen AB54. Starts ASAP. Ongoing work - Work till 2027. Working 7am-7pm Monday to Friday with 1 hour break. 55 hours per week. Saturdays available. £26.00 per hour.
Duties to include working on a large civils project, operating the Dozer machine. Orange PPE only. D&A testing onsite.
